NAD+ injections bypass digestion, while oral NAD-support supplements such as nicotinamide riboside (NR) or nicotinamide mononucleotide (NMN) must be absorbed and converted by the body. Oral precursors have human evidence for raising NAD-related biomarkers, but clinical outcome data are limited. No NAD+ form is proven to extend human lifespan or specifically reduce belly fat.

What is NAD+ and why are people taking it?
NAD+ is short for nicotinamide adenine dinucleotide. It helps cells turn food into ATP, the energy currency your cells use, and it is involved in normal mitochondrial function and DNA repair-related pathways 2.
NAD+ also works with enzyme families such as sirtuins and PARP enzymes. Sirtuins are linked to stress-response and metabolic signaling, while PARP enzymes use NAD+ during DNA damage responses 2. These mechanisms are why NAD+ is discussed in aging biology and longevity research.
But mechanism is not the same as proof. A pathway can look important in cells, animals, or biomarkers without proving that a treatment makes humans live longer. Current reviews describe NAD+ biology as promising but still uneven across routes, populations, and outcomes 1, 3.
How do oral NAD+ supplements work?
Most oral “NAD+” products are actually NAD+ precursors, such as NR, NMN, or nicotinamide, also called NAM. The body absorbs these vitamin B3 derivatives and uses metabolic steps to contribute to NAD+ pathways 1.

Nicotinamide riboside, or NR, has been tested in human studies. In a 2016 human study, single oral NR doses increased blood NAD+ metabolites, showing that oral NR can enter NAD-related pathways in people 4.
Nicotinamide mononucleotide, or NMN, has also been studied in humans. In a randomized trial of postmenopausal women with prediabetes, NMN improved skeletal-muscle insulin signaling, but the trial did not prove weight loss or lifespan extension 6.
Why digestion matters
Oral products must pass through digestion and metabolism before they can affect NAD-related pools. That means bioavailability may vary by product, person, gut function, and the specific precursor used 1.
Convenience is the main advantage. Oral supplements are non-invasive and fit easily into a daily routine. The trade-off is that supplement quality varies, and most human studies focus on blood or tissue biomarkers rather than clear symptom, weight, or longevity outcomes 3.
How do NAD+ injections work?
NAD+ injections are designed to deliver NAD+ without first passing through the digestive tract. That can make the delivery route more direct than oral precursors, but direct delivery is not the same as proven superiority for energy, cognition, weight loss, or longevity.
The key safety issue is sterility. FDA has warned that food-grade NAD+ ingredients are not suitable for sterile compounding without appropriate processing because microbes and endotoxins can harm patients 8. FDA has also received adverse event reports after NAD+ injectable drugs, including severe chills, shaking, vomiting, and fatigue, with some cases needing medical treatment 8.

Is NAD+ injection better than oral NAD+?
There is no single best form for everyone. Injection, oral, nasal, and IV NAD+ routes differ in convenience, supervision, absorption assumptions, and safety needs, but current human evidence does not prove one route is best for all healthy adults.
| Route | What it is | Main advantage | Main limitation | Evidence level |
|---|---|---|---|---|
| Oral NR, NMN, or NAM | NAD+ precursors taken by mouth | Convenient and non-invasive | Must pass through digestion and metabolism; supplement quality varies | Human trials show biomarker changes; clinical outcome data are limited |
| NAD+ injection | Injected NAD+ that bypasses digestion | Clinician-guided route may offer more controlled delivery | Requires sterile compounding and medical review; injection reactions and contamination risks matter | Less direct human outcomes evidence than oral precursor biomarker studies |
| NAD+ nasal spray | Nasal compounded route | Non-injection option for eligible patients | Limited human outcomes data for longevity claims | Evidence is still developing |
| NAD+ IV infusion | NAD+ delivered by intravenous infusion | Direct IV delivery with visit-based monitoring | More time-intensive and not the same as take-home injection | Human outcomes data remain limited |
In short, oral precursors have more published human biomarker studies, while injections offer a route that bypasses the gut. Neither fact proves better real-world outcomes for every patient. Benefits, side effects, contraindications, and monitoring should be considered together 1, 8.
What does the human evidence say about NAD+ for energy, metabolism, and longevity?
The human evidence is strongest for NAD-related biomarker changes, not for proven human lifespan extension. Some trials show oral precursors can raise NAD+ metabolites or affect metabolic markers, but results vary by study and population.
Human randomized evidence
In a randomized trial of healthy middle-aged and older adults, chronic NR supplementation was reported to be well tolerated and increased NAD+ metabolism markers, but the study was not designed to prove longer life 5. In obese insulin-resistant men, another randomized trial found NR did not improve insulin sensitivity or several metabolic health measures 7.
For NMN, a randomized trial in postmenopausal women with prediabetes found improved muscle insulin sensitivity and insulin signaling, but this does not mean NMN is a proven weight-loss or anti-aging treatment 6. A separate randomized study in older men reported that oral NMN affected some physical performance measures, but it did not prove lifespan extension 9. Individual results vary.
Human observational, animal, and cell evidence
Human observational evidence can show associations between NAD-related biology and health states, but it cannot prove that taking NAD+ changes an outcome. Animal and cell studies help explain mechanisms, such as mitochondrial signaling and DNA repair pathways, but they should not be treated as proof of human longevity benefits 3.
The honest bottom line: NAD+ research is biologically interesting. It is not proof that NAD+ injections, oral precursors, nasal spray, or IV therapy extend human lifespan.
Does NAD+ reduce belly fat or cause weight loss?
No NAD+ route should be framed as a stand-alone belly fat or weight-loss treatment. Some NAD+ precursor studies look at insulin signaling or metabolic markers, but those are not the same as proven body-fat reduction 6, 7.
If weight loss is the main goal, it deserves its own medical evaluation. What about celebrity NAD+ trends?
Searches like “what NAD do the Kardashians use” are common, but celebrity use is not medical evidence. A treatment can be popular online and still have limited human outcomes data.
A better filter is simple: ask what route was used, whether it was clinician-guided, whether the product came from a licensed source, what outcome was measured, and whether that outcome was a biomarker or something patients can actually feel. Influencer anecdotes cannot answer those questions.
